StringBuilder如何控制字符串回车换行?
sb.Append(" if(xhttp.readystate==4) ");
sb.Append(" { ");
sb.Append(" if(xhttp.status==200) ");
sb.Append(" { ");
sb.Append(" msg=xhttp.responseXML.getElementsByTagName('list'); ");
sb.Append(" div=''; ");
sb.Append(" for(var i=0;i<msg.length;i++) ");
sb.Append(" { ");
sb.Append(" divshow +=Message[i].getElementsByTagName('fromuser')[0].text+' '+Message[i].getElementsByTagName('createdtime')[0].text+'\r\n+' '+Message[i].getElementsByTagName('content')[0].text+'\r\n';");
sb.Append(" } ")
我的问题:
1.红色这块代码,它是从另一个aspx页面返回的,但我要控制它的格式(divshow),我需要它回车,但是,这样写ajax代码报错,字符串不能连接起来. 我把\r\n换成空格,就可以传参到另一个aspx页面,但我要控制它回车,应该怎么做?
------解决方案--------------------
\r\n 是传递給js的,到了js那里
就成了
js函数(参
数)
这样换行,当然错误啦。
要传递\\r\\n